DEAR Inventory: REST API. Authentication: Account ID plus application key sent as request headers. SAP Hana: SQL over the SAP HANA client (JDBC/ODBC drivers); OData/REST via XS for app-layer access. Authentication: Dedicated database user credentials over an encrypted TLS connection (password sent hashed); Kerberos, SAML, JWT, and X.509 certificate authentication are also supported. SAP HANA Cloud enforces TLS and IP allowlisting. Stacksync manages authentication, retries, and rate limits on both sides.
SAP Hana: System-versioned temporal tables are supported only on column store tables, not on the row store. DEAR Inventory: Inventory availability is derived per location from transactions (receipts, sales, adjustments, transfers), so synced stock figures reflect movement history rather than a single editable field.
